Governor Simon Lalong of Plateau
State yesterday advised his predecessor, Senator Jonah David Jang, to
brace himself for more probes as more committees will be set up, saying
“Jang will be invited to give stewardship of his eight years in office”.

Lalong, in an apparent reply to Jang’s
statement on Monday where he (Jang) said Lalong’s efforts at probing him
was a ploy to distract people’s attention from the burning issue of
grazing reserves/ranches, said he was only following Jang’s footstep,
given he set up a committee to probe the Joshua Dariye administration on
assumption of office.

It would be recalled that
ViewPointNigeria had last week reported that Senator Jang reacted to
PLSG’s inauguration of a committee to investigate the purchase and
distribution of vehicles on loan to members of the public when he was
governor under the Tackling Poverty Together programme.

A statement signed by Lalong’s Director
of Press and Public Affair, Samuel Emmanuel Nanle, yesterday said
government wonders how a simple task of reviewing a revolving loan
empowerment programme guided by terms of reference could elicit the kind
of reaction it did from Jang.

“As the days roll by and the EFCC settle
to address the issues of the State SURE-P funds, the state primary
education funds, the CBN N2bn SME funds meant for youth empowerment, the
deductions for five km road projects in 17 local governments areas, the
ASTC Project, the several bank charges and payment of commissions
beyond regulatory limits, amongst the many politically motivated
contract beneficiaries with the loop financial benefits to government
officials; we shall see how he (Jang) retreats shamelessly into his
cocoon. Let Senator Jang not lose sleep yet, for the days ahead will
give him enough reasons to,” the statement said.

On Tuesday the 14th
of June, 2016, the Secretary to the Government of Plateau State, Hon.
Rufus Bature inaugurated on behalf of Government a Committee to
investigate the purchase and distribution of vehicles and tricycles on
Loan to members of the Public by the immediate past Administration of
Ex- Governor Jonah David Jang. The 9-Point Terms of Reference of the
Eight (8) Man Committee includes amongst others the following;

  1. To investigate the number of vehicles purchased under the tackling poverty together scheme.
  2. To establish the total amount and source of funding of the purchase vehicles.
  3. To establish the mode of distribution of the vehicles names and addresses of beneficiaries.
  4. To identify the bank and ascertain the total amount deposited by each beneficiary as loans repayment.
  5. To recover the vehicles of balance payments from defaulting beneficiaries.
  6. To advice Government on how to sanitize the programme for sustainability.

Governor
Lalong is not an escapist nor is he a coward; he is bold enough to
confront situations headlong and as such cannot use the constitution of
the Committee as a distraction from the on-going debate on the Grazing
Policy. Former Governor Jang is the one who should bury his face in
shame for denying his acceptance of the recommendation for the creation
of grazing reserves in the Justice Niki Tobi JSC white Paper on the
Report of the Judicial Commission of Inquiry into the Civil Disturbances
in Jos.  In the white paper endorsed by Former Governor Jang; Item
3.137 reads “We therefore recommend that Government in conjunction
with communities should provide Grazing Areas and Permanent Routes for
cattle to enable the Fulani feed their cattle without interference to
farmlands, this should not affect only the Beroms and the Irigwes in Jos
South, Riyom, Barkin Ladi and Bassa, but other Local Government Areas
where there could be similar animosity building up and bursting out into
physical hostility in the future”
.
